Rain and Snow Starting Today; Snow Dropping Down to 1500 Feet on Thursday
Graphic from the National Weather Service.
Much needed rain will be arriving today. The National Weather Service predicts that it should be mostly showers and light rain during the day with heavier rain arriving tonight. Then a cold front will sweep down from the north.
Starting Thursday at 4 a.m. through Saturday morning, snow is predicted above 1500 feet in the interior mountains from the Oregon border into Mendocino County. There will likely be multiple rounds of snow showers, according to the National Weather Service. In places, they say there could be accumulations of up to 18 inches. In addition, the National Weather Service warns “Highways impacted include 199, 299, 101, 36, and 162.”
According to the National Weather Service,
Snow totals for this event will range from a few inches in the coastal mountains to 3 feet or more over the highest elevation of Trinity County and the Yolla Bollys with significant snows at many passes.
